Roasted Red Pepper Ranch Cheese Ball

Roasted Red Pepper Ranch Cheese Ball made with cream and cheddar cheese, roasted red peppers and seasonings is an easy, festive appetizer for any event.

Ingredients

  • 8 ounces cream cheese softened
  • 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
  • 2-1/2 tbsp ranch seasoning mix
  • 1/2 tsp hot sauce
  • 3 tbsp roasted red pepper diced (from a jar)
  • 2 tbsp parsley fresh snipped

Instructions 

  • In a medium bowl, use a hand mixer to mix cream cheese, shredded cheese, ranch seasoning and hot sauce until completely blended. Fold in roasted red pepper until evenly dispersed. Scrape down sides of bowl and form mixture into a ball.
  • Place on plastic wrap, wrap tightly and chill until firm, about 2 hours.
  • Place parsley in a pie plate or flat dish,  unwrap cheese ball onto plate and gently roll in parsley until all sides are coated. Serve.
  • Store leftovers tightly covered in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.

Chef Tips

Cheese ball is best served when softened.
